What Is a Judgment Lien on Property in Pontiac?
Quick, Definitive Answer
A judgment lien is a legal claim on a debtor's property, resulting from a court judgment. This lien can attach to real estate in Pontiac, Michigan, affecting the owner's ability to sell or refinance the property until the debt is satisfied. According to Sonic Title, these liens are recorded in public records, creating an encumbrance that must be cleared before transferring ownership. This ensures that creditors are paid what they are owed before any proceeds from a property sale are distributed to the seller. In Pontiac, this process is crucial for maintaining clear property titles and ensuring fair transactions. The presence of a lien can also affect the property's market value, as potential buyers might be wary of the additional legal steps involved. Therefore, understanding and resolving liens is essential for a successful property sale.

How Judgment Liens Work in Pontiac
Key Details and Process Steps
Judgment liens in Pontiac are created when a creditor wins a lawsuit against a debtor. The court issues a judgment, which can then be recorded as a lien against the debtor's property. Here are the key steps involved:
- The creditor files a lawsuit and wins a judgment against the debtor.
- The judgment is recorded with the local county clerk's office, attaching to any real property owned by the debtor in Pontiac.
- The lien remains until the debt is paid or the property is sold, at which point the lien must be satisfied.

Common Mistakes and Expert Tips
Mistakes to Avoid
One common mistake is neglecting to conduct a comprehensive title search before listing a property for sale. This oversight can lead to last-minute surprises that delay closing. Another error is assuming that a lien will automatically be resolved without taking proactive steps. Sonic Title advises against these pitfalls, emphasizing the importance of addressing liens early. Ignoring these liens can lead to legal complications and financial losses. Engaging with experienced professionals can prevent these costly errors and ensure a smoother transaction process. Additionally, failing to communicate openly with all parties involved can result in misunderstandings and further delays. Clear communication is key to resolving lien issues efficiently.
